Knowledge teeth are the last teeth to appear within the mouth. When they line up correctly and periodontal cells is healthy and balanced, wisdom teeth do not have to be eliminated.
Impacted wisdom teeth can take several settings in the bone as they attempt to discover a path that will certainly allow them to efficiently erupt. These inadequately positioned impacted teeth can create many issues. When they are partially appeared, the opening up around the teeth allows germs to grow and will at some point trigger an infection.
The pressure from the emerging wisdom teeth might relocate other teeth and interfere with the orthodontic or natural placement of teeth. One of the most severe issue takes place when lumps or cysts form around the impacted wisdom teeth, causing the destruction of the jawbone and healthy and balanced teeth. Removal of the offending knowledge teeth typically settles these troubles.
Early elimination of wisdom teeth is most safe. Affected teeth are removed by making a laceration in the periodontal to reveal the tooth.
Sutures will certainly hold the gum tissue with each other as soon as the tooth has actually been removed, and will either liquify by themselves or be removed. Aching joints and muscles are additionally typical complying with surgical procedure. If a section of the bone was eliminated, weakening of the jaw can happen. Sinus and nerve issues can likewise occur however are incredibly uncommon. Infection is rare yet can occur; symptoms include high temperature, swelling, pain, and an extended nasty taste in the mouth.
For the initial 2 days following the procedure, your child needs to consume soft food and stay well moisturized. Throughout the initial three to five days, see to it you or your teenage avoids the following: Sucking liquids through straws Cigarette Energetic rinsing of the mouth Hard or sticky foods Exercise Any of these might interfere with the embolism and delay recovery.

People are typically first assessed in the mid-teenage years by their dental expert, orthodontist, or by a dental and maxillofacial specialist.
Affected wisdom teeth need to be gotten rid of before their origin framework is fully developed. In some people it is as very early as 12 or 13, and in others it might not be till the very early twenties. Issues often tend to occur with boosting regularity after the age of 30. Several of the possible issues connected to not removing your wisdom teeth include: One of the most constant clinical problem we see is pericoronitis, (a local periodontal infection).
Affected wisdom teeth might add to crowding of your teeth. This is most noticeable with the front teeth, mainly the reduced front teeth and is most generally seen after a client has had braces. There are a number of aspects that trigger teeth to group after dental braces or in early the adult years.
When it is needed to eliminate influenced wisdom teeth in your thirties, forties or past, the post-operative course can be extended and there is a higher issue price. Treating these complications is frequently harder and less predictable than with a younger individual. Healing may be slower and the possibility of infection can be enhanced.
Generally, you will certainly recover much faster, more naturally and have less issues if treated in your teens or early twenties. In many individuals, wisdom teeth do not break via the periodontal and grow out or part of them does. Approximately 80% of young adults in Europe have at the very least one wisdom tooth that hasn't broken through. This is much more typical in the reduced jaw than it remains in the upper jaw.
Other teeth might after that hinder of the wisdom tooth, or it might be available in jagged. Knowledge teeth that don't break via (in some cases also called "impacted" knowledge teeth) usually do not create any type of problems. They sometimes lead to pain, swelling, tooth degeneration or swollen gum tissues. Impacted knowledge teeth may likewise press various other teeth off the beaten track.
The decision about whether or not to have knowledge teeth drew will mostly rely on whether they are already creating trouble or whether it is extremely most likely that they will certainly in the future. It is very important to get the answer to the following concerns before having any type of knowledge teeth eliminated: Have your knowledge teeth already created pain or damages to your jaw or nearby teeth, or exists an enhanced danger of that occurring? Are the wisdom teeth protecting against the other teeth from developing properly? Might the wisdom teeth hinder various other oral or jaw-related therapies that are already planned? What dangers are related to surgical procedure? Could the wisdom teeth "replace" molars (back teeth) that are missing or terribly damaged?
